"Brazilian green science has technology and purpose," says organic cosmetics producer.

A pioneer in the manufacture of 100% organic cosmetics in Brazil, Soraia Zonta, a businesswoman from Santa Catarina and founder and CEO of the company Bioart, located in Greater Florianópolis, has just launched products from her brand in Paris. She explains that she chose the French capital to launch her biodermocosmetics because it was there that she began her international career in the field, was invited to give a lecture on sustainable entrepreneurship at the University of Paris Saclay, and also to show the world that Brazil can have global leadership in the production of sustainable cosmetics.

In March of this year, Soraia Zonta was recognized with the United Nations (UN) Global Green Chemistry Award in the Women-Led Initiatives category and was invited to become a UN Green Chemistry Ambassador.

While leading the development of new products at Bioart, she also gives lectures highlighting her career in the green chemistry industry, focusing on research, innovation, and sustainability. At the Soubio Experience event on the 12th of this month in Florianópolis, she spoke about entrepreneurship and purpose.

She also presented products at the event's trade show that she launched in Paris, such as a vegan bioserum and a resveratrol-based skin cream. In the following interview, the businesswoman talks about the company, her journey, and the current phase of her career, with lectures in Brazil and abroad on sustainable cosmetics following recognition from the UN. You are the founder of Bioart, a pioneering company in the manufacture of organic and natural dermocosmetics. How did the business begin?
– Bioart started out of a very personal need. I've always had skin allergies and, for many years, I couldn't find products that worked well for me. This difficulty sparked an enormous curiosity in me about ingredients, formulations, and environmental impacts.

My studies and practical projects were cradled in France, Italy, and Japan – where I honed my skills and developed the ability to anticipate trends and seek solutions for Brazil's challenges, thus transforming my own problems into innovative green technologies.

Gradually, I transformed this search for care into a purpose, and my journey led me to a leading role for women in the green and sustainable beauty segment in my country. Bioart emerged from the desire to create effective, clean, and conscious products that care for the skin without harming the planet.

I realized how much the national beauty industry needed to evolve towards a more ethical and sustainable relationship with the environment and with people. We started with few resources, but with a very clear vision: to unite science, green technology, nature, and purpose in each bioformula. I remember that in the beginning everything was handcrafted, full of trial and error. I myself tested, created, reformulated… Bioart was born from this love for nature and the genuine desire to do things differently, and that's what it does today.

What are the biggest challenges in manufacturing organic cosmetics?
Producing organic and sustainable cosmetics is a great challenge because it requires absolute respect for nature's timing; ingredients are not always available in the same quality or quantity, and each harvest brings its own particularities.

Furthermore, maintaining the effectiveness of the formulas without resorting to synthetic substances demands a great deal of research, patience, and innovation. Every detail counts, including the packaging, which is also designed to be sustainable. It's a slower process, but also a more genuine one; cleaner and more conscious.

Each product embodies the strength of conscious work, done responsibly from the producer to the skin of those who trust the brand. Many brands call themselves natural, clean, and sustainable beauty brands, but in practice they are nothing of the sort. This is where the great challenge of information reaching the national consumer lies. That's why we are always striving to bring awareness and truthful information to the consumer.
